We are looking for Workforce Planning Specialist.
Within the Organizing Committee’s People Management team, the Workforce Planning function is
accountable for efficient and effective planning of the organisational structure required for a
successful staging of the Olympic and Paralympic Games, including coordination of workforce,
management and forecasting of personnel budgets, Games-time scheduling & rostering and
Workforce services during Games Time. The role could be frequently engaged with other functional
areas of the Fondazione Milano Cortina 2026, with members of external committees and with top
management.
· Support staff requirements for various operational roles critical to the success of the
Olympics and Paralympics games
· Forecasting of personnel budgets liaising with HR Administration and all impacted
functional areas in order to gain in-depth understanding of specific contents of each activity;
· Maintain an accurate data bases of actual Workforce (Hiring, termination, Cost center,
movements) and aligned with Forecast Plans;
· Analytics preparation on demand base on Games Operations request.
· Supporting HR cost controlling for all HC data collection processes and ensure effective
communication and transfer information between all stakeholders.
· Responsible to define effective procedures to maintain Venues organisation charts, job roles,
parameters for assessing the number of resources required for each role, budgets, etc.
· Effective collaboration with the workforce service & operations area, supporting the
development of required toolkits, policies and ensure information transfer when need it.(e.g.
Scheduling and Rostering) and procedures to support the Workforce Planning process;
